[/* Please see the Gnulib manual for how to use these macros.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
   Suppress extern inline with HP-UX cc, as it appears to be broken; see
 | 
						|
   <https://lists.gnu.org/r/bug-texinfo/2013-02/msg00030.html>.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
   Suppress extern inline with Sun C in standards-conformance mode, as it
 | 
						|
   mishandles inline functions that call each other.  E.g., for 'inline void f
 | 
						|
   (void) { } inline void g (void) { f (); }', c99 incorrectly complains
 | 
						|
   'reference to static identifier "f" in extern inline function'.
 | 
						|
   This bug was observed with Oracle Developer Studio 12.6
 | 
						|
   (Sun C 5.15 SunOS_sparc 2017/05/30).
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
   Suppress extern inline (with or without __attribute__ ((__gnu_inline__)))
 | 
						|
   on configurations that mistakenly use 'static inline' to implement
 | 
						|
   functions or macros in standard C headers like <ctype.h>.  For example,
 | 
						|
   if isdigit is mistakenly implemented via a static inline function,
 | 
						|
   a program containing an extern inline function that calls isdigit
 | 
						|
   may not work since the C standard prohibits extern inline functions
 | 
						|
   from calling static functions (ISO C 99 section 6.7.4.(3).
 | 
						|
   This bug is known to occur on:
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
     OS X 10.8 and earlier; see:
 | 
						|
     https://lists.gnu.org/r/bug-gnulib/2012-12/msg00023.html
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
     DragonFly; see
 | 
						|
     http://muscles.dragonflybsd.org/bulk/clang-master-potential/20141111_102002/logs/ah-tty-0.3.12.log
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
     FreeBSD; see:
 | 
						|
     https://lists.gnu.org/r/bug-gnulib/2014-07/msg00104.html
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
   OS X 10.9 has a macro __header_inline indicating the bug is fixed for C and
 | 
						|
   for clang but remains for g++; see <https://trac.macports.org/ticket/41033>.
 | 
						|
   Assume DragonFly and FreeBSD will be similar.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
   GCC 4.3 and above with -std=c99 or -std=gnu99 implements ISO C99
 | 
						|
   inline semantics, unless -fgnu89-inline is used.  It defines a macro
 | 
						|
   __GNUC_STDC_INLINE__ to indicate this situation or a macro
 | 
						|
   __GNUC_GNU_INLINE__ to indicate the opposite situation.
 | 
						|
   GCC 4.2 with -std=c99 or -std=gnu99 implements the GNU C inline
 | 
						|
   semantics but warns, unless -fgnu89-inline is used:
 | 
						|
     warning: C99 inline functions are not supported; using GNU89
 | 
						|
     warning: to disable this warning use -fgnu89-inline or the gnu_inline function attribute
 | 
						|
   It defines a macro __GNUC_GNU_INLINE__ to indicate this situation.
 | 
						|
 */
